How To Install Kdenlive on Ubuntu 20.04 LTS

Install Kdenlive on Ubuntu 20.04

In this tutorial, we will show you how to install Kdenlive on Ubuntu 20.04 LTS. For those of you who didn’t know, Kdenlive is one of the most popular open-source video editors. Kdenlive is known for its ability to support multiple video formats, such as 3Gp, MKV, MP4, etc., in addition to providing loads of powerful features to its users. Some of the most prominent features include multi-tracks for audio and video editing, a variety of effects and transitions, and customizability.

Install Kdenlive on Ubuntu 20.04 LTS Focal Fossa

Step 1. First, make sure that all your system packages are up-to-date by running the following apt commands in the terminal.

sudo apt update
sudo apt upgrade

Step 2. Installing Kdenlive on Ubuntu 20.04.

  • Install Kdenlive from the PPA repository.

If you’re running Ubuntu 20.04 LTS you can install Kdenlive via the project’s official stable release PPA:

sudo add-apt-repository ppa:kdenlive/kdenlive-stable

Finally, enter the following command to install Kdenlive on the Ubuntu system:

sudo apt update
sudo apt install kdenlive
  • Install Kdenlive from the Snap store.

Run the following command to install Snap packages:

sudo apt install snapd

To install Kdenlive, simply use the following command:

sudo snap install kdenlive

Step 3. Accessing Kdenlive on Ubuntu.

Once installed launch from the Unity Dash (or equivalent app menu).
